Featured Articles are always detailed, relevant and well-presented, with good use of images, structure and formatting. Some Featured Articles will make good use of tables, galleries and other advanced formatting features.

For an article to become Featured, it must be inspected by an Administrator who will then add it to the [[Grand Theft Wiki:List of Featured Articles|List of Featured Articles]] (LOFA) page, and they will add the [[Template:Featured|<nowiki>{{featured}}</nowiki>]] template, which shows a star in the top right corner. '''Only Administrators can officially approve Featured Articles'''.
Extracts of featured articles are put into templates: [[Template:FA/1]], [[Template:FA/2]] etc. These are then shown on the [[LOFA|List of Featured Articles]], and can be exported. The template [[Template:FA/top|<nowiki>{{FA/top}}</nowiki>]] should be used at the top of each extract.


If you think an article should become a featured article, please request the status on the [[{{TALKPAGENAME}}|discussion]] page.
